Job description

Description

Job Overview: The Office Coordinator, under the direction and supervision of the Community Manager and FirstService Residential provides superior customer service to homeowners; is responsible for assisting in the daily office operations of the Association; responds promptly to resident inquiries and concerns and resolves issues in a timely efficient manner. This includes but is not limited to all office tasks as outlined below. The hours are Monday - Friday 7:30 a.m. - 4:00 p.m. There may be occasional hours outside of this schedule to support the events hosted by the Association or to provide coverage for weekend shifts.

Communication with Homeowners
  • Foster a welcoming and friendly environment for homeowners, staff, and vendors.
  • Assist with Communicating with homeowners about activities on the property, which may affect them via Connect, Email, Phone, Posting signs in message board etc.
  • Respond to homeowner’s questions and concerns on a timely basis.
  • Assist in providing individualized communications to homeowners about pertinent matters.
  • Assist in planning, organizing, and communicating details of all Association events to residents, and be present for association planned events
Manage Building Information
  • Key management and adherence to unit entry policies
  • Assist in maintaining Connect database of homeowners and property information as well as utilizing it as a form of communication.
  • Assist in maintaining calendars of building activities.
  • Help to ensure that information utilized by other staff is kept current.
Violations Oversight
  • Must have comprehensive knowledge of the rules and regulations, Declaration, and expectations of the Board of Directors.
  • Drives around the property to perform violation inspections of the community.
  • Processes the violation letters upon completion of each inspection.
  • Tracks violation status and conducts repeat inspections accordingly to ensure compliance or need to elevate the violation.
Building Maintenance
  • Assist in maintaining updated Vendor List.
  • Help to coordinate day-to-day building maintenance issues with staff and/or vendors and make sure that proper authorization for the job is acquired before starting project.
Respond to Resident Inquiries and Requests — General
  • Respond to homeowner’s questions and concerns. The office is the central on-site contact for addressing homeowner questions and concerns.
  • Answer all incoming calls, answer all emails, and voice mails in a timely manner.
  • Write Work Orders for On-Site Maintenance Tasks.
Order Services/Approve Payments
  • Help to place orders for supplies and services needed for the Association.
  • Submit charge forms to Association in a timely manner for charges and payments made by owners.
Miscellaneous Duties/Projects
  • Work on miscellaneous projects, as necessary or as requested by the Community or Association Manager.
  • Sort, label and log packages and deliveries. Monitor package room.
  • Work on miscellaneous duties and tasks as necessary for proper operation of the building.
Connect
  • Assist in maintaining all owner and renter information in Connect.
  • Assist in maintaining updated association information with Community Manager and Association Manager.
  • Help to distribute memos, letters, and other relevant information to homeowners.
